Chapter Thirteen
Riku's eyes slowly opened as the television in front of him blared loudly. Even with that, the first thing he did was just close his eyes again and pull a pillow over his head. He was lying in his small apartment on the only couch he had right in the living room-kitchen, which was the first room to see as soon as anyone walked in.
He tried to ignore everything and just go back to drifting, but now all he could focus on the sound. With a groan he forced himself to sit up, feeling a small strain in his back from sleeping on such a rugged sofa. He reached for the remote right next to him and turned off the television as soon as he found the right button. Finally, some silence.
'Sunday,' was his first thought, next picking up the digital clock and checking the time. '7:00. God, it's way too early.'
Everything he needed on a daily basis was right there on a tiny table in front of him. It had a busted leg, one that needed to be propped up with a book to match the height of the others, but at least it still worked. He barely had anything that was in complete working condition; on his salary, he felt lucky to be able to afford anything at all.
Right on cue, as if someone knew when he was going to wake up in the morning Riku heard a loud knock. Instead of answering it he laid himself back on the couch and shut his eyes even tighter, pretending to be asleep this time so the intruder would go away. At the same time however, he knew it wouldn't work. This person was one of the most persistent of any people he knew. "I'm not home. Go away."
He heard a small laugh from the other side of the door and as the knob turned, in walked Sora with a grin on his face. He seemed to do this every morning now, since Riku refused to go anywhere near Sora's house.
Riku never wanted to go over to that house ever again. It wasn't Cloud, or Aerith, or even Sora that bothered him. It was their mother. She reminded exactly of what he would have felt like had he been allowed to stay back home so he could feel that gauche, unsettling tension in the air every single day. There was no way he was going to walk right into something like that again, especially if he could see everyone he actually liked in other places.
"Come on," Sora said as he leaned his stomach over the arm of the couch, balancing his body as he tried to purposefully shake Riku awake. He knew he was annoying the older of the two by doing so, and it only amused him more. "I thought country bumpkins had energy so they could work in the fields."
"Bite me," Riku retorted coldly before pulling the covers over his head.
Things were hard to get used to after that. At first whenever he looked at Sora, mainly when he either delivered the paper or came by after school to the post office, all he could think about was everything that happened to him all at once. It was something not easy to get used to at all. But at the same time, Sora never brought it up or even acted like Riku knew. He would always just smile and wave, or somehow get caught up in a conversation that would have them arguing like normal.
'Still,' Riku thought, at last shoving Sora off the side of the couch and stretching his arms above his head. 'It's been over a month since then . . . I guess things are fine. I feel fine.'
He really felt okay.
Sora stuck out his tongue as he caught his footing on the ground and pulled a newspaper -the last one- out of his large pants pocket and threw it on the table with the rest of Riku's things. There were four other papers from the days before, all wrapped perfectly and untouched. Instead of getting annoyed by it he went to the side of the room that was the kitchen and pulled out two cups of Instant Ramen along with two glasses, not even bothering to ask since he had done it before. Quickly he filled the two glasses with water and put them both in a small microwave at the same time, setting them to heat for a few minutes.
"So, anything new?" Sora asked, leaning against the tiny kitchen counter. It was more like an old dresser someone threw out. "Can't say there's much going for me."
"Me either," Riku replied nonchalantly, acting as if he were barely paying any attention to the conversation. He leaned forward and pushed the five newspapers on his floor and picked up a small brochure, holding it up in Sora's direction to make sure it caught his eye. "This is the only thing exciting."
Sora squinted his eyes to read the title, then he pouted. "'Golden Life'? That place for people who are messed up in the head? Cloud and Aerith have been trying to get me to go there for years."
"That's why I have it," the older of the two replied, flipping through the small pages and scanning through it. He shrugged and grinned. "I'm supposed to 'enlighten' you. Convince you to go."
"You know those places are full of shit, right?"
"Why do you think I haven't gone to one?"
"Why would you need to go to one?"
Riku paused, drawing in his breath and keeping it. For a while he was being careless, a little too friendly. He did trust Sora; he really did, or he trusted him more than anyone else. But still, no one around this place had any business knowing his past or why he was in the city in the first place, just as he had told himself over and over again.
Finally he sighed, lightly closing his eyes and smiling a bit. 'I almost really slipped . . .'
Sora decided to ignore Riku's actions. For the time that he had known him, he had come to the conclusion that Riku was just plain weird in all aspects. It was probably what drew himself to like him so much, as a friend more than anything. Because he came from the country knowing nothing of whom he was or how others generally treated him, he found a sort of comfort in coming to him.
'Of course, he knows all that now,' Sora thought, turning around as he heard the beeping sound for the microwave. He turned around and pulled out the glasses, then he opened the two Ramen cups to pour the water in. He grinned. 'Still, he's not acting any different. He's been an asshole ever since I met him, but probably the best asshole out there at the same time.'
Glancing over to another part of the small apartment, Sora found two doors hidden in the back corner. One was tightly shut, but the other one had a crack in it. Looking back at Riku and confirming that he went to lie down again ('Lazy,' Sora thought he snuck over to the two doors, just pushing the one that was already open enough to slip inside.
As soon as he saw it, he had known it was Riku's actually room, the one he was supposed to be sleeping on. It was completely messy, and even after over a month and a half moving boxes were still piled haphazardly everywhere and there wasn't a bed set up for him to sleep him; only an old, worn out mattress.
"Wherever he came from, it couldn't have been much worse than this," Sora muttered as something on the mattress caught his eye. On top of a single pillow was a large, thick album, already opened with pictures pressed in and hanging out all over the place, as if Riku were still working on getting them all in place. The room was dark and Sora wasn't going to risk turning it on, but he could see well enough.
He sat down on the mattress and pulled the photo album on his lap, suddenly looking at the pictures in admiration. The very first thing to get his attention was a young, ginger-haired girl with smiling violet eyes and creamy white skin. Every photo had her in it, sometimes with a group of others laughing and grinning, but without a doubt she was the main focus of them all.
'Wow,' Sora thought, turning the page backwards towards the beginning the album and finding more of the girl. 'She's really cute for a girl . . .'
One picture I particular slid out of its place as he turned the page, the first one that Sora saw with both him and a much more cheerful looking Riku. He had his arm around the young girl's neck as if pulling her into a sort of friendly hug, and she was holding out a cell phone towards the camera. Sora turned it over and found writing on the back.
'Happy 13th Birthday! Kairi's new cell. Better take care of it, 'cause I paid a lot of money for it!'
"Kairi," Sora whispered, the name rolling off his tongue. On the lower corner of the picture was an actual number, one he assumed was for the cell phone. 'I wonder who she is.'
